Researchers test sugary solution to Alzheimer`s

Sunday, February 26, 2012 - 17:30 in Health & Medicine

(Medical Xpress) -- Slowing or preventing the development of Alzheimer’s disease, a fatal brain condition expected to hit one in 85 people globally by 2050, may be as simple as ensuring a brain protein’s sugar levels are maintained.
